    I have a 98 Carver Mariner 350. Two 454lxi's with V drives. Wondering if anyone out there with the same setup happens to know what the GPH is? I know it depends on what a person carries in it but a rough, educated guess would work.

    A rule of thumb is that a gas engine uses 10 gallons per hour per 100 horse power-hour. My 37 Tolly had 330 HP 454s and used 66 gallons per hour at WOT. Cruising at 2700 RPM I used about 28 gallons per hour total and made 17 knots. Your actual GPH will be different but close to this number. Also I find that V-drive are less efficient than straight drives so your consumption will probably be more. Hope this helps.
